Transaction 31419690a44c7c15731a2005c0985154bab83e8143cbd105f7572f6e26a11788
1 Input
1 Output
-
31419690a44c7c15731a2005c0985154bab83e8143cbd105f7572f6e26a11788:0
- value
- 286937
- script pubkey
- OP_0 OP_PUSHBYTES_20 741a1faa694039179c99f219682bb774ef806ca5
- address
- bc1qwsdpl2nfgqu308ye7gvks2ahwnhcqm99nujh42